NETSDK1195: анализ совместимости с кодом для обрезки, однофайлового развертывания или предварительной компиляции не поддерживается для целевой платформы.
NETSDK1195 указывает, что вы используете функцию пакета SDK, который недоступен для выбранной целевой платформы. Следующие функции зависят от пакета ILLink, который доступен только при выборе и более поздних версиях netcoreapp3.0
:
- Обрезка (через
PublishTrimmed
илиPublishAot
) - Анализ обрезки (с помощью
PublishTrimmed
,PublishAot
,IsTrimmable
IsAotCompatible
илиEnableTrimAnalyzer
) - Анализ однофайлового файла (через
PublishSingleFile
илиEnableSingleFileAnalyzer
) - Анализ компиляции заранее (через
PublishAot
илиEnableAotAnalyzer
)
Чтобы устранить эту ошибку, выберите поддерживаемый TargetFramework
параметр или отключите параметр, требующий пакета ILLink.
Совместная работа с нами на GitHub
Источник этого содержимого можно найти на GitHub, где также можно создавать и просматривать проблемы и запросы на вытягивание. Дополнительные сведения см. в нашем руководстве для участников.